Test plan: Pavebox kiosk watchdog, v3 cycle.

Plugin authors: the watchdog restarts the shell if heartbeats stop for 20s. Your plugin must not block the main loop. Tests cover forced hangs, slow renders, and restart storms. Run the suite against the Pavebox sandbox only. Sandbox requests authenticate with the bearer token below.

login token, bagug-kafop: eyJhbGciOiJIUzI1NiIsInR5cCI6IkpXVCJ9.eyJzdWIiOiIcMLov2In0.Z5RLDIfp

## Break-Glass Access: Pairwise Matcher GC Pauses

When the Lumenfold matching service hits prolonged garbage-collection pauses, match latency can exceed the 30-second SLO and the queue backs up. Release managers may invoke break-glass access to restart the JVM pool directly, bypassing the normal deploy gate. This requires unlocking the emergency credentials store on the ops bastion. Use the recovery passphrase below to unseal it.

vault phrase of tawig-taduf = zorath-oliwyn

It runs in three environments: dev (synthetic schedules only), staging (mirrors production job definitions with alerts muted), and production (live paging). When investigating drift, always compare staging and production timestamps first, since clock-sync issues surfaced there before anywhere else. Do not hand-edit timers on hosts; change them through Cronwatch. Production currently runs with these values.

settings of tagef-bawif:
DRUIX_HOST=druix.zemvarlabs.internal
DRUIX_PORT=8000

TURN-208: Gatevale turnstile counters at the Merrow Field pilot double-count when a rotation reverses mid-cycle. Attendance totals drift roughly 2% high per event. The debounce window fix is implemented, reviewed by Ilsa, and soak-tested across two simulated match days without drift. Ready for your cut; the candidate build is identified below.

trace token, tagag-tafog: htk6_5ed18c